Explaining researchers’ achievements to the Romanian public
The EU-funded HSciRO project will raise public awareness about scientific research and technology and how they impact daily life. It will show how researchers try to invent technology, investigate the natural world and search for vaccines and cures for diseases. The project will organise events and activities in six Romanian cities (Bucharest, Iasi, Cluj, Timisoara, Sibiu and Craiova) that are considered the regional cultural and administrative capitals. HSciRO will organise several open-air and amusing activities performed by scientists and students. The project will also share information on significant research infrastructures in Romania (e.g. the ELI project) and include EU corners dedicated to the European Research Area and Horizon 2020.
